DC microgrid for lighting systems

Name: DC microgrid for lighting systems

Ecosystem: Power grids

Application area: DC power supply to local lighting systems

Key facts: Preconfigured solution for implementing a DC microgrid for test purposes, with connection to the AC grid. It includes all the components required for assembly and therefore provides an ideal, customisable starting point for your project planning.

  • At the heart of the system is an AFE infeed unit with an output of 80 kW to supply DC current on the secondary circuit. In its basic configuration, the AFE is capable of supplying between 650 VDC and 840 VDC. The DC grid is earthed on the AC side, with the positive and negative conductors having polarity symmetrical to the earth. The AFE pre-charges the secondary circuit to avoid high starting currents.
  • This application sample will provide you with complete documentation for a DC grid, including a circuit diagram and a comprehensive list of the components and products from the various manufacturers included in this system, to use as the starting point for designing your own DC microgrid.
  • To meet the requirements of a test setup, additional specifications were submitted:
    • Operation of a three-phase B6 rectifier.
    • Operation of a variable transformer as the principal AC supply, so that the secondary circuit can be supplied with a minimum voltage of 400 VDC.
